  • S3055E BP – Bordetella Pertussis DNA Diagnostic Kit

    Brief

    Pertussis, also known as whooping cough, is a highly contagious respiratory infection caused by the bacterium Bordetella pertussis. Pertussis spreads easily from person to person mainly through droplets produced by coughing or sneezing. The disease is most dangerous in infants, and is a significant cause of disease and death in this age group.

     

    Sansure kit is used to detect Bordetella pertussis DNA present in the nasopharyngeal swab specimens by applying PCR fluorescence probing technique. The detection result can be used as an aid in the diagnosis of bordetella pertussis.

  • S3353E FluA/Flu B – Influenza A/B Virus Nucleic Acid Diagnostic Kit

    Brief

    Influenza Virus is a kind of RNA virus in the Orthomyxoviridae family which leading to human and animal influenza. It causes acute upper respiratory tract infection, spreads rapidly through the air and has periodic pandemics around the world. Human influenza virus are influenza pathogens which can be classified into three types, namely A, B and C. Among them, influenza A is the most harmful, while influenza B and influenza C have weak pathogenicity and are not easy to mutate.

     

    The diagnostic Kit is intended for detection of the Influenza A and Influenza B in oropharyngeal swab from individuals. The test results can be used for the auxiliary diagnosis of respiratory Influenza A/B Virus infection and provide molecular diagnostic basis for Influenza A/B Virus infection.

  • S3363E-12-P TB and RFP – Mycobacterium Tuberculosis Nucleic Acid and Rifampicin Resistance Fluorescence Diagnostic Kit

    Brief

    Mycobacterium tuberculosis (M. tuberculosis) is the pathogen causing tuberculosis, which can invade all organs of the whole body, and pulmonary tuberculosis caused by pulmonary involvement is the most common. Early diagnosis and treatment are crucial measures to effectively control the spread of tuberculosis.

     

    Due to the abuse of antibiotics or the insufficient course of drugs of patients, the sensitivity of patients to drugs weakens or even disappears, resulting in the decreasing or ineffective effect of drugs on pulmonary tuberculosis. According to the types of anti-tuberculosis drugs, drug-resistant tuberculosis can be divided into monoresistance pulmonary tuberculosis, polyresistance pulmonary tuberculosis, multidrug resistance pulmonary tuberculosis and extensively drug-resistant pulmonary tuberculosis. Rifampicin is one of the first-line drugs for the treatment of pulmonary tuberculosis.

     

    The Mycobacterium Tuberculosis and Rifampicin Resistance Nucleic Acid Diagnostic Kit (PCR-Fluorescence Probing) is a real-time polymerase chain reaction test kit intended for the qualitative detection of the nucleic acid of mycobacterium tuberculosis and rifampicin resistance mutations in human sputum samples. The test results can be used to assist in the diagnosis of TB patients and patients with an increased risk of RFP drug-resistant TB, providing a molecular diagnosis basis for infected patients.

  • S3334E ADV – Adenovirus Nucleic Acid Diagnostic Kit

    Brief

    Acute infectious disease caused by adenovirus, easily affects the mucous membranes of the respiratory and digestive tracts, the conjunctiva of the eyes, the urinary tract and the lymph nodes. The main manifestation is an acute upper respiratory tract infection. The population is generally susceptible, mostly the children. Infants are susceptible to adenovirus pneumonia, which is severe and has a high mortality rate. The source of infection is the patient and the latent infected person. The virus is excreted from the respiratory tract and conjunctival secretions, feces and urine, and is transmitted by airborne droplets, close contact and the feces-oral route.   The Adenovirus Nucleic Acid Diagnostic Kit is used for nucleic acid testing of adenovirus in patients suspected of being adenovirus infections (e.g., fever, cough, wheezing, dyspnea, bronchopneumonia, upper respiratory tract infections, lung infections, etc.) or related close contacts, and the results can be used to assist in the diagnosis of adenovirus infection and provide a molecular diagnostic basis for adenovirus infection.

  • S3310E 6LRP – Six Respiratory Pathogens Multiplex Nucleic Acid Diagnostic Kit

    Brief

    Lower respiratory infections (LRP) remained the world’s most deadly communicable disease, ranked as the 4th leading cause of death. In 2019 it claimed 2.6 million lives. Diseases of the lower respiratory tract include acute tracheitis, bronchitis, pneumonia, chronic bronchitis, chronic obstructive pulmonary disease, bronchiectasis, etc. They are caused by microbial infections such as viruses, bacteria, mycoplasma, chlamydia and legionella.   Bacteria are the main pathogens of lower respiratory tract infections, with a wide variety of pathogens and complex clinical presentations. Due to the long detection period and low positive detection rate of traditional pathogenic tests, over 62% of adults with community-acquired pneumonia have no pathogenic basis. Failure to identify the cause quickly can delay treatment, exacerbate the disease and lead to death, and increase the development of antibiotic resistance.

  • S3053E EV/EV71/CA16 – Enterovirus/Coxsackievirus A16/Enterovirus 71 RNA Diagnostic Kit

    Brief

    Hand-foot-and-mouth disease is a common childhood disease caused by enteroviruses. Most of the patients will have a fever and get vesicle rash in the mouth or on the hand and foot. A few patients will get cephalomeningitis, cerebritis, neurogenic pulmonary edema and myocarditis, etc. Some patients may get sequelae of this disease or even death. The viruses that can cause hand-foot-and-mouth disease include Coxsackievirus, new-type enterovirus and ECHO virus, of which the most common types are Coxsackievirus A16 and Enterovirus 71. The laboratory diagnosis methods mainly include virus isolation, nucleic acid detection, etc.   The Enterovirus/Coxsackievirus A16/Enterovirus 71 RNA Diagnostic Kit (PCR-Fluorescence Probing) is intended to detect Enterovirus, Coxsackievirus A16 and Enterovirus 71 in throat swab by applying real-time quantitative PCR technique. The detection results can be used to distinguish Coxsackievirus A16 and Enterovirus 71.

  • S3014E HCMV – Human Cytomegalovirus DNA Quantitative Fluorescence Diagnostic Kit

    Brief

    Human cytomegalovirus (HCMV), also called cell inclusion body virus, is a double helix DNA virus and belongs to β genus of herpes virus family, which causes infected cells to enlarge and has a huge intranuclear inclusion. The ways of infection of HCMV is mainly through contact, blood transfusion, intrauterine and birth canal, and the infections are commonly found in fetus, newborns, pregnant women, etc. If the pregnant women are infected, it may cause their newborns congenital monstrosity. When the organism immune deficiency or immune system is under inhibitory state, people can be easily infected by HCMV, such as the patients receiving immunosuppressive therapy after transplantation of organ, the patients receiving malignant tumor chemotherapy and AIDS patients, etc. If these patients are infected by HCMV, it usually causes high mortality and serious diseases.   Clinical tests suggest that HCMV infection hasn’t specific manifestations and it causes harm to multiple organs, especially the liver and lung. A statistical analysis of positive and negative rate of HCMV in various kinds of clinical indications shows HCMV infection is probably related with various diseases, such as Cytomegalovirus hepatitis, Infant hepatitis syndrome, liver dysfunction, pneumonia, Bronchitis, Upper respiratory tract infections, enteritis, enterocolitis, diarrhea, hematemesis, heart failure, etc.   The Human Cytomegalovirus DNA Quantitative Fluorescence Diagnostic Kit (PCR-Fluorescence Probing) is an in vitro nucleic acid amplification test for the detection of HCMV DNA in human urine, serum and peripheral blood samples. It is intended for use as an aid in the diagnosis of an HCMV infection and for observing drug efficacy.

  • S3015E EBV – Epstein-Barr virus DNA Quantitative Fluorescence Diagnostic Kit

    Brief

    Epstein-barr virus (EBV) is known to be the first virus that is definitely related with human tumors. EBV infection mainly causes infectious mononucleosis in children and tumor-related diseases such as Burkitt’s lymphoma, lymphoid tissue hyperplasia in immunocompromised individuals, primary lymphoma, empyema associated lymphoma, T-cell lymphoma, NK cell lymphoma/leukemia, Hodgkin’s disease, nasopharyngeal carcinoma, stomach cancer, lymphoid epithelial tissue cancer, smooth muscle tumors, etc.   The Epstein-Barr virus DNA Quantitative Fluorescence Diagnostic Kit (PCR-Fluorescence Probing) is an in vitro nucleic acid amplification test for the quantification of Epstein-Barr Virus (EBV) DNA in peripheral blood. Test result can be used as an aid in the diagnosis of an EBV infection and in observation of drug efficacy.

  • S3057E HPV 13+2 – Human Papillomavirus DNA Diagnostic Kit

    Brief

    Base on the study results by WHO International Agency for Research on Cancer (IARC) and other international organizations, the 13 kinds of genotypes including HPV16, 18, 31, 33, 35, 39, 45, 51, 52, 56, 58, 59, 68 are classified as high-risk HPV, and the 5 kinds of genotypes including HPV26, 53, 66, 73, 82 are classified as medium-risk HPV.   Human Papillomavirus DNA Diagnostic Kit (PCR-Fluorescence Probing) chooses the above 13 kinds of high-risk genotypes and two popular kinds of medium-risk genotypes that are HPV 53 and 66 to be the target genotypes, in order to guarantee that the kit is capable of cervical carcinoma screening and risk evaluation. Moreover, it is clearly indicated that the females at the age of 30 or above who have no abnormal cervical cytology but the HPV detection is positive, especially for HPV16 and HPV18 infected females, should get vaginoscopy immediately. Therefore, the diagnostic kit can be used for detection of the 15 kinds of target genotypes and also subtype identification of HPV16 and HPV18.

  • S3148E SC2/Flu/RSV – SARS-CoV-2, Influenza Virus and Respiratory Syncytial Virus Multiple Nucleic Acid Diagnostic Kit

    Brief

    The SARS-CoV-2, Influenza Virus and Respiratory Syncytial Virus Multiple Nucleic Acid Diagnostic Kit (PCR-Fluorescence Probing) is a real-time RT-PCR test intended for the qualitative Diagnostic of nucleic acid from SARS-CoV-2, Influenza Virus and Respiratory Syncytial Virus Multiple in the nasopharyngeal swabs and oropharyngeal swabs from individuals.

     

    As the seventh coronavirus that infects humans, the SARS-CoV-2 can cause fever, fatigue, dry cough, dyspnea and other symptoms. In severe cases, it can cause acute respiratory distress syndrome, septic shock, and even death. At the same time, the SARS-CoV-2 has a strong spreading ability and has a wide range. Influenza virus (Influenza virus) can cause acute respiratory infections, with clinical manifestations of fever, headache, myalgia, fatigue, rhinitis, sore throat and cough. Influenza viruses can aggravate underlying diseases (such as heart and lung diseases) or cause secondary bacterial pneumonia or primary influenza viral pneumonia. The elderly and people with various chronic diseases or physical weakness are prone to severe complications and mortality higher after infecting influenza. Respiratory syncytial virus (RSV) belongs to the Pneumovirus genus of the Paramyxoviridae family. It mainly causes lower respiratory tract infections such as bronchiolitis and pneumonia in infants under 6 months, as well as rhinitis , Cold and other upper respiratory tract infections in older children and adults.
